3 origins of law -Answer-Constitutional, statutory and case law 
Constitutional Law -Answer-Rules and provisions found in the federal and state 
constitutions 
Statutory Law -Answer-Written laws enacted by a legislative body 
Case Law -Answer-Previous appellate court decisions that are binding on lower court 
decisions (know as precedent) 
Primary purpose is to interpret constitution and clarify statutes
